Hi, I have a Sharepoint List Form customized in PowerApps. My SharePoint Site has the standard Permission Groups (Owners, Members, Visitors). Is it possible to hide/display data cards in Power Apps based on those Permission Groups?
For example:
If (user is NOT in Owners or Members group), hide the Status and Notes fields.
Hi @juphi17 ,
You will need to create a Power Automate to get the current user groups, but this can solve your problem.
